This connector creates bi-directional data exchange between TIBCO Spotfire® and BIOVIA Pipeline Pilot®, allowing the creation of workflow-based applications that combine advanced data access and manipulation with powerful interactive visualizations.
It combines the power of visual analytics with advanced scientific data handling.
-
The connector includes four main modules:
Pipeline Pilot Data Functions & Calculated Columns: For easy bi-directional data integration
Client Automation SDK: Allows developers to programmatically interact with Spotfire through JavaScript
S.W.A.P.P (Spotfire Web Application for Pipeline Pilot): A low-code framework to streamline protocol integration
Pipeline Pilot Automation Tasks: Generate Spotfire documents server-side from Pipeline Pilot protocols

Pipeline Pilot Data Functions require no programming skills.
They work in all Spotfire clients (Analyst, Web Player Consumer, Web Player Business Author, and Automation) and provide a standardized integration mechanism supported by Spotfire.
-
Common use cases include:
Retrieving data from Pipeline Pilot protocol execution without developing an interface
Sending multiple Spotfire records (entire data tables, marked rows, selected columns) to Pipeline Pilot for processing
Interacting with protocols based on events like form changes or marked records
Writing back to databases/filesystems
Delivering custom data tables to Web Player users
-
Calculated Columns extend Spotfire's native column calculation concept to use Pipeline Pilot protocols as calculation engines. For example, instead of using standard Spotfire functions, you can execute a Pipeline Pilot protocol directly within a column expression like: executeProtocol_String('Protocols/Expression Functions/Calculate', [Structure], 'ECFP_6').
-
S.W.A.P.P (Spotfire Web Application for Pipeline Pilot) is a low-code framework to streamline Pipeline Pilot protocol integration. It was co-developed with AstraZeneca.
Users declare the Pipeline Pilot protocol, map parameters to a web form (wizard), and define actions on Spotfire documents based on protocol output files. It's ideal for creating custom web applications without extensive coding.
-
The Client Automation SDK allows developers to programmatically interact with the Spotfire C# client API through JavaScript.
It runs in both Analyst and Web Player clients, leverages modern JavaScript libraries (Angular, React.js, D3.js, Vue.js), works with Pipeline Pilot and other web-capable technologies, and is used to build advanced mashup applications.
-
Automation Tasks are used to generate Spotfire documents server-side from the execution of Pipeline Pilot protocols.
The use case is creating Spotfire documents with dynamic content on a schedule or based on events, with the new documents prepared and stored in the Spotfire Library automatically.

The connector is compatible with Spotfire 7.11 LTS and 10.3 LTS, and Pipeline Pilot 2017 R2 through 2020.
(Note: These are the versions mentioned in the documentation; current versions may differ).
-
The connector uses developer annual licenses.
Developers need licenses to create protocols and applications using Connector components, but end-users can execute protocols and applications with no restriction.
